Scope and Contents

Carbon copies of correspondence from George Eastman regarding African hunting trip. Includes travel itineraries. Materials date from 1927 and 1928.

Biographical / Historical

After his retirement from the company he founded, Eastman Kodak, in 1925, George Eastman took up a standing offer from Martin and Osa Johnson to go on an African safari. Eastman was a an inveterate traveler, and Martin Johnson, a Kodak sales agent from Missouri, had interested him in going to Africa following Johnson's own travel there in the early 1920s. Johnson had used the trip to demonstrate the capability of Kodak equipment for wildlife photography through a film entitled Trailing African Wild Animals, and Eastman saw similar potential in his own safari. Eastman was a fastidious planner whose detailed preparations involved sending out over 200 boxes of supplies prior to his own departure for Kenya on December 14, 1927. Accompanied by Dr. Albert D. Kaiser, Eastman traveled to the Kedong Valley of Kenya, where he went on a photo safari. He returned to Africa in 1928, this time to hunt, bagging several trophies.
